如何利用PHP和SQLite高效设计并优化数据模型?
- 内容介绍
- 文章标签
- 相关推荐
本文共计1598个文字,预计阅读时间需要7分钟。
PHP与SQLite:如何进行数据模型设计和优化在Web开发领域,数据模型的设计和优化至关重要。一个良好的数据模型可以提升应用程序的效率和可扩展性。SQLite作为一种轻量级的数据库,常用于PHP项目中。以下是进行数据模型设计和优化的关键点:
1. 合理设计表结构: - 使用适当的字段类型和大小,避免浪费存储空间。 - 确保每个表都有一个主键,并考虑使用外键来维护数据完整性。
2. 优化查询性能: - 避免全表扫描,通过索引提高查询效率。 - 使用预编译语句和参数化查询,防止SQL注入并提高性能。
3. 使用合适的索引: - 根据查询模式创建索引,如经常作为查询条件的字段。 - 注意索引的维护成本,过多的索引可能会降低写操作的性能。
4. 合理使用缓存: - 对于频繁访问的数据,使用缓存可以减少数据库的负载。 - 考虑使用内存缓存如Redis,或数据库层面的缓存机制。
5. 数据库连接管理: - 使用连接池来管理数据库连接,避免频繁地打开和关闭连接。 - 适当配置连接池的大小,以平衡性能和资源消耗。
6. 定期维护: - 定期进行数据库优化,如重建索引、检查数据完整性等。 - 监控数据库性能,及时发现并解决潜在问题。
SQLite作为轻量级数据库,适用于小型项目和原型设计。它易于配置和使用,但在处理大规模数据或高并发访问时可能存在性能瓶颈。因此,在设计数据模型时,应充分考虑SQLite的特点和限制。
PHP和SQLite:如何进行数据模型设计和优化
导言:
在Web开发领域,数据模型的设计和优化是至关重要的一部分。一个良好的数据模型可以提高应用程序的效率和可扩展性。而SQLite作为一种轻量级数据库系统,经常被用于小型应用或移动应用的开发中。
本文共计1598个文字,预计阅读时间需要7分钟。
PHP与SQLite:如何进行数据模型设计和优化在Web开发领域,数据模型的设计和优化至关重要。一个良好的数据模型可以提升应用程序的效率和可扩展性。SQLite作为一种轻量级的数据库,常用于PHP项目中。以下是进行数据模型设计和优化的关键点:
1. 合理设计表结构: - 使用适当的字段类型和大小,避免浪费存储空间。 - 确保每个表都有一个主键,并考虑使用外键来维护数据完整性。
2. 优化查询性能: - 避免全表扫描,通过索引提高查询效率。 - 使用预编译语句和参数化查询,防止SQL注入并提高性能。
3. 使用合适的索引: - 根据查询模式创建索引,如经常作为查询条件的字段。 - 注意索引的维护成本,过多的索引可能会降低写操作的性能。
4. 合理使用缓存: - 对于频繁访问的数据,使用缓存可以减少数据库的负载。 - 考虑使用内存缓存如Redis,或数据库层面的缓存机制。
5. 数据库连接管理: - 使用连接池来管理数据库连接,避免频繁地打开和关闭连接。 - 适当配置连接池的大小,以平衡性能和资源消耗。
6. 定期维护: - 定期进行数据库优化,如重建索引、检查数据完整性等。 - 监控数据库性能,及时发现并解决潜在问题。
SQLite作为轻量级数据库,适用于小型项目和原型设计。它易于配置和使用,但在处理大规模数据或高并发访问时可能存在性能瓶颈。因此,在设计数据模型时,应充分考虑SQLite的特点和限制。
PHP和SQLite:如何进行数据模型设计和优化
导言:
在Web开发领域,数据模型的设计和优化是至关重要的一部分。一个良好的数据模型可以提高应用程序的效率和可扩展性。而SQLite作为一种轻量级数据库系统,经常被用于小型应用或移动应用的开发中。

